Hello All,
4 months ago I was struck in the drivers side of my vehicle by a loaded school bus that ran a stop sign on a rural county road. I was cut out by the first responders who saved my life(Thank you). I dont remember any of the accident and very little if any of icu or the hospital stay at all. I was given several units of blood and had head surgery. I broke my neck, sternum, ribs, massive open head wound and suffer from TBI. As my Neck and bones have healed I still suffer from vertigo, speech issues, cognitive issues, tinnitus, hearing loss, depth perception and massive headaches. I am in therapy daily and am getting tired. Anyway dont want to bring anyone down and thank you for having me on your forum. |

Hi Idaho, welcome. Don't worry about bringing us down that's what we are here for. My TBI was over 18 months ago; I wish I would have found the forum sooner. Check out the TBI/PCS forum (tamiloo's link above), that's where a lot of us TBI survivors hang out.
Like you I don't remember my accident or much about the time I spent in ICU, but I'm grateful to the 1st responders and surgeons and other doctors who saved my life. I do recall the daily therapy, it was exhausting but that and time has (mostly) healed the deficits from my TBI. Best to you on your recovery journey. ![]()
__________________
What Happened: On November 29, 2010, I was walking across the street and was hit by a light rail commuter train. Result was a severe traumatic brain injury and multiple fractures (skull, pelvis, ribs). Total hospital stay was two months, one in ICU followed by an additional month in neuro-rehab. Upon hospital discharge, neurological testing revealed deficits in short term memory, executive functioning, and spatial recognition. Today: Neuropsychological examination five months post-accident indicated a return to normal cognitive functioning, and I returned to work approximately 6 months after the accident. I am grateful to be alive and am looking forward to enjoying the rest of my life. |
